Detached Garages in Florida

A detached garage is a fully enclosed structure, so the first planning question in Florida is not wind alone — it is what the ground under the slab is doing. USGS mapping shows large portions of Florida are low-lying, and the state sits over the Floridan aquifer system, a principal USGS-studied aquifer covering roughly 100,000 square miles. That combination makes slab elevation and drainage a genuine site question before layout is finalized. Florida also leads all U.S. states in recorded direct hurricane hits according to NOAA's Hurricane Research Division, and the statewide Florida Building Code that the Florida Building Commission administers carves out a High-Velocity Hurricane Zone in Broward and Miami-Dade counties — a documentation path other counties do not follow. And with Florida farms averaging 217 acres in the 2022 Census of Agriculture, a detached garage here is often one of several accessory buildings on a larger rural parcel rather than a single urban add-on. The intersection

For an enclosed structure, Florida's ground comes first

A detached garage's slab and enclosed walls put site elevation and drainage ahead of wind in the planning sequence, even in a hurricane-exposed state.

USGS mapping derived from digital elevation models highlights that large portions of Florida sit on low-lying ground. For an open carport that mostly affects footing depth; for a fully enclosed detached garage with a poured slab, it also affects how the slab sits relative to surrounding grade and where stormwater goes once it hits the roof. Neither this page nor a generic planning guide can set your specific slab elevation — that is a site-engineering and local-department question — but the ground condition is real enough to raise before a layout is finalized.

The Floridan aquifer system, a principal USGS-studied aquifer covering about 100,000 square miles, underlies the entire state. That is not the same thing as a shallow water table on any individual parcel, but it is part of why a Florida excavator or engineer's read on a specific site is more useful than a general assumption drawn from a neighboring project.

Documentation

Hurricane history and a code-defined zone shape the paperwork

Florida's hurricane record is well documented, and the state's own building code splits documentation requirements by county even though it is a single statewide code.

NOAA's Hurricane Research Division records Florida as the U.S. state with the most historical direct hurricane hits, based on its 1851-2018 dataset. That backdrop is why an enclosed structure like a detached garage — with windows, a roof and often a garage door, all of which can become failure points in wind — gets more product-approval scrutiny in Florida than in many states.

The Florida Building Commission administers one Florida Building Code statewide, but that code also names a High-Velocity Hurricane Zone limited to Broward and Miami-Dade counties. A detached garage's door, window and roofing product approvals inside that zone follow a documented path the rest of the state does not use. Confirm with your county building department whether your parcel falls inside it before you finalize door and window specifications.

Preparation

Before you request a Florida detached garage quote

Four steps that keep an enclosed, hurricane-exposed structure from needing a mid-project redesign.

  1. Ask about slab elevation and drainage for your specific parcelLow-lying ground in parts of Florida means this should not be assumed from a nearby project.
  2. Confirm HVHZ status with your county building departmentBroward and Miami-Dade have a distinct product-approval documentation path for doors, windows and roofing.
  3. Plan access if the garage is one of several rural outbuildingsOn larger parcels, driveway routing and setback from other structures matters more than on a single urban lot.
  4. Fix vehicle count and workshop space before orderingRetrofitting a workshop bay after a garage is built is far costlier than sizing it in up front.
  5. Ask whether the garage roofline needs to tie into the house's existing drainageA detached garage sited close to the main house can redirect roof runoff toward the house's own foundation if gutters and grading are not planned together.
  6. Confirm the garage door's wind-load rating with your supplierAn enclosed door is a load-bearing wall element and its rating should match the rest of the structure.
